Non-verbal communication refers to the transmission of messages or information without the use of words. It includes body language, facial expressions, gestures, posture, eye contact, and even tone of voice. This form of communication can convey emotions and intentions, often complementing or contradicting verbal messages. It plays a crucial role in interpersonal interactions and can influence the interpretation of spoken communication.
